From Research to Practice: Advancing Early Intervention, Treatments and Services for Children and Young People with Intellectual Disabilities
Bringing together leading experts across multiple disciplines, this conference will present the latest research evidence and good practice examples in the delivery of early intervention approaches, supports and treatments, as well as health services for children and young people with intellectual disabilities. The conference aims to provide a reflective, evidence-based, and practical learning approach for multidisciplinary professionals interested in the health and care of children and young people with intellectual disabilities.
Topics include:
- Early Intervention to support behaviours that challenge in children with intellectual disabilities: the research evidence
- Mapping Services for Children with Intellectual Disabilities and Behaviours that Challenge: Findings from the MELD Research Study
- The Autism and Intellectual Disability Intensive Interaction Team (AID-IIT): an innovative model of intensive support
- Communication Interventions for Children with Intellectual Disabilities
- Theory and Practice of Psychotherapy with Adolescents with Learning Disabilities
- Supporting Children with Intellectual Disabilities who present with ARFID
